About Bakhar Chandiha Village

Bakhar Chandiha is one of the larger villages in Purnahiya tehsil, in the district of Sheohar, Bihar.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 8,938, made up of 4,714 males and 4,224 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 896 females per 1000 males. The village covers 520.8 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 843334,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.

Getting to Bakhar Chandiha

The census records public bus service for Bakhar Chandiha as Available within 10+ km distance. Private bus service is recorded as Available within <5 km distance. For rail, the census notes the nearest railway station as Available within 5 - 10 km distance. These entries describe what was recorded in 2011 and services may have changed since.
